Most of the existing image encryption schemes with the substitution-diffusion structure are not secure and efficient. In this letter, a chaos-based pseudo-random bit generator with good statistical properties is proposed, where a simple post-processing by compressing is employed. A new adaptive image encryption scheme with the substitution-diffusion architecture is designed using the new pseudo-random bit generator. In the scheme, the session key for the pseudo-random bit generator is dependent on the content of the image which ensures that the scheme can effectively resist known-plaintext and chosen-plaintext attacks. Theoretical analysis and computer simulation indicate that the proposed algorithm is efficient and highly secure.
